Classic children's picture book, with the 27 original color illustrations. According to Wikipedia: "Helen Beatrix Potter (28 July 1866 22 December 1943) was an English author, illustrator, natural scientist and conservationist best known for her imaginative children’s books featuring animals such as those in The Tale of Peter Rabbit which celebrated the British landscape and country life."
